How we protect
specialty items

The equipment and habits that make the difference between a careful move and a claim.

Floor, corner and banister guards

Runners on floors, guards on corners and railings, pads on elevator walls before anything moves.

Blanket wrap and shrink wrap

Quilted blankets against every finish, shrink wrap to hold them, corner protectors on fine furniture and framed pieces.

Boards, skids and specialty dollies

Piano boards, stair-climbing safe dollies, four-wheel dollies and ramps rated for the weight of the item.

Custom crating

Built-to-fit crates for marble tops, oversized glass, sculptures and instruments that cannot travel in a carton.

Team carries and route planning

Crew size set by weight and stairs, the route walked before the lift, tight turns and doorways measured in advance.

Tie-downs and placement

Strapped and braced in the truck, then placed exactly where you want it, reassembled and checked before we leave.

What counts as a specialized move?

Anything that needs more than a standard crew and dolly: pianos, safes, antiques, fine art, marble and glass, lab and medical equipment, golf carts, hot tubs, exercise machines and estates. Each is planned around the item’s weight, value and access before move day.

How much does it cost to move a piano or a safe?

Local grand piano moves typically run $400 to $800 and uprights less, quoted flat. Safes, artwork and exercise equipment are quoted individually by weight, size and stairs. Golf carts are quoted flat by distance.

Do you move lab and medical equipment?

Yes. Lab benches, instruments, freezers, imaging and medical equipment are moved by crews with the right dollies, padding and protocols, coordinated with your facility and vendors. See the lab moving page for details.

Can you move a golf cart?

Yes. Golf carts, utility carts and mobility scooters move locally and long distance in covered trucks with ramps and strapping systems, including gated communities and HOA rules. We can store them too.

Are specialty items covered if something happens?

Every move includes California’s $0.60-per-pound valuation. For high-value pianos, art, antiques or equipment we recommend Full Value Protection or a third-party policy, arranged with your quote.
